Amphotericin B是从链霉菌(Streptomyces nodosus)菌株产生的多烯类抗真菌抗生素。IC50 =0.028-0.290μg/ml
体外实验:Amphotericin B是治疗许多危及生命的真菌感染的有效药物。在表达TLR2和CD14的细胞中,Amphotericin B诱导信号转导和炎症细胞因子释放。在表达TLR2、CD14和衔接蛋白MyD88的原代鼠巨噬细胞和人细胞系中,Amphotericin B诱导NF-κB依赖性报告子活性和细胞因子释放,而细胞缺乏任何一个均对Amphotericin B没有反应。具有TLR4突变的细胞对Amphotericin B刺激的反应比表达正常TLR4的细胞反应弱[1]。Amphotericin B可与哺乳动物膜的主要固醇,即胆固醇相互作用,由于其具有相对高的毒性,限制了Amphotericin B的有用性[2]。在悬浮于等渗蔗糖溶液中的负载KCl的脂质体中,低浓度AmB(≤ 0.1 μM)诱导极化电位,表明K+渗透。大于0.1 μM AmB允许阳离子和阴离子运动。在悬浮在等渗NaCl溶液中的LPs中, 0.05 μM AmB导致负膜电位几乎完全崩溃,表明Na+进入细胞[3]。
在体实验:在仓鼠瘙痒病模型中,Amphotericin B延长了孵育时间,降低PrPSc积累。在具有传染性亚急性海绵状脑病(TSSE)的小鼠中,Amphotericin B显著降低PrPSc含量[4]。

细胞实验[1]: | |
细胞系 |
腹膜巨噬细胞; 表达TLR2和CD14的HEK293细胞 |
溶解方法 |
在DMSO中的溶解度>46.2mg/mL。为了获得更高的浓度,可以将离心管在37℃加热10分钟和/或在超声波浴中震荡一段时间。原液可以在-20℃以下储存几个月。 |
反应条件 |
1、2和4 μg/ml |
应用 |
在来自CD14敲除小鼠(C57BL/6 CD14 - / - )和CD14野生型(C57BL/6 CD14 + / +)小鼠的腹膜巨噬细胞中,Amphotericin B无法诱导来自CD14 - / - 小鼠的巨噬细胞中TNF-α的产生。表达TLR2和CD14的HEK293细胞对Amphotericin B(1,2和4μg/ ml)的响应更强烈。 |
动物实验[2]: | |
动物模型 |
仓鼠瘙痒病模型 |
剂量 |
2.5 mg/kg; 接种后0-7天注射 |
应用 |
在瘙痒病大脑内感染的仓鼠中,Amphotericin B显著延长生存时间14.7天。 |
